DOM window.load.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. If this feature is set, the browser will omit the Referer header, as well as set noopener to true.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. In general, you should only use a link for navigation to a real URL. If you want to add more, just use addEventListener(), which is the preferred way for adding events. Your first snippet of code will run as soon as browser hit this spot in HTML. UI interactions are ineffective ( window.open, alert, confirm, etc.) Do roots of these polynomials approach the negative of the Euler-Mascheroni constant? To view the purposes they believe they have legitimate interest for, or to object to this data processing use the vendor list link below. Can archive.org's Wayback Machine ignore some query terms? The consent submitted will only be used for data processing originating from this website. Here you can see an example of HTML page source code that uses the window.onload method for auto-execution to display an alert box. To catch load events on the window, that load event must be dispatched directly to the window. Moving your script to the bottom also solved that issue and now there's no need to use window.onload since your body and content will have already been loaded. It will run the function as soon as the webpage has been loaded. addEventListener is better than onload because multiple scripts can use it.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, execute a function only if condition is satisfied inside for loop, window.onload inside of Astro js not working, Javascript: My setTimeout function not working because of 3rd party, How does onunload impact page performance, Call a function from another javascript program - functional programming. Thats actually the delay until the DOMContentLoaded event. Specifies the width of the content area, including scrollbars. To learn more, see our tips on writing great answers. A window is opened. Finally, assign an image URL to the src attribute. Is it possible to create a concave light? . It is fired after: beforeunload (cancelable event) pagehide. Some time ago browsers used to show it as a message, but as the modern specification says, they shouldnt. After this session the project has been created; a new window is opened on the right side. Most of the entries in the NAME column of the output from lsof +D /tmp do not begin with /tmp. Find centralized, trusted content and collaborate around the technologies you use most. It is invoked only once when the view is instantiated. How to run TypeScript files from command line? Functions are the basic building block of any application, whether they're local functions, imported from another module, or methods on a class. Difference between var and let in JavaScript, Convert a string to an integer in JavaScript. Home JavaScript DOM JavaScript onload. When the sendBeacon request is finished, the browser probably has already left the document, so theres no way to get server response (which is usually empty for analytics). Is it suspicious or odd to stand by the gate of a GA airport watching the planes? In Javascript, the declaration of a new property within any object, is very simple and there's even 2 ways to do it: // Declare programatically window.MyProperty = function () { alert ("Hello World"); }; // Declare with Brackets window ["MyProperty"] = function () { alert ("Hello World"); }; The Window variable, is an object, therefore to . Is it possible to rotate a window 90 degrees if it has the same length and width? First off, putting scripts at the top and using window.onload is an anti-pattern. If JavaScript support is disabled or non-existent, then the user agent will create a secondary window accordingly or will render the referenced resource according to its handling of the target attribute. The minimum required value is 100. The following options are supported: If this feature is enabled, it requests that a minimal popup window be used. When extreme changes in context are explicitly identified before they occur, then the users can determine if they wish to proceed or so they can be prepared for the change: not only they will not be confused or feel disoriented, but more experienced users can better decide how to open such links (in a new window or not, in the same window, in a new tab or not, in "background" or not). How to validate if input in input field has float number only using express-validator ? Enter the name of your application like "RecursiveFunction", after that click on the Ok button. Give the name of your application as "Page_load_Time" and then click "Ok". The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Let's say we gather data about how the page is used: mouse clicks, scrolls, viewed page areas, and so on. Index Properties Event Target application Cache caches client Information closed console crypto custom Elements default Status device Pixel Ratio do Not Track document event external frame Element frames history indexedDB inner Height What is the point of Thrower's Bandolier?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. How to make JavaScript execute after page load? These features include options such as the window's default size and position, whether or not to open a minimal popup window, and so forth. Which means, following code may not work: Instead, in such handlers one should set event.returnValue to a string to get the result similar to the code above: What happens if we set the DOMContentLoaded handler after the document is loaded? Instead of solely relying on the presence of this feature, we can provide an alternative solution so that the site or application still functions. It sends the data in background. Paste the given code in the created text file. Considering the alert() function, it doesn't really matter at which point it will run (it doesn't depend on anything besides window object). Connect and share knowledge within a single location that is structured and easy to search. Function parameters are typed with a similar syntax as variable declarations. External style sheets dont affect DOM, so DOMContentLoaded does not wait for them. How to validate if input in input field has integer number only using express-validator ? Inside window.onload function(){}) will run as soon as all page resources are loaded. Wed like our function to execute when the DOM is loaded, be it now or later. What is the correct way to screw wall and ceiling drywalls? Enable JavaScript to view data. First, create an image element after the document has been fully loaded by placing the code inside the event handler of the windows load event. JavaScript is best known for web page development but it is also used in a variety of non-browser environments. How To Add Google Translate Button On Your Webpage? How to check whether the background image is loaded or not using JavaScript ?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. For example: window.addEventListener ('load', function () { alert ('hello!'); }, false); Share Follow In the above example, when a user clicks on the paragraph element in the html, they will see an alert showing onclick Event triggered. How to check if a jQuery plugin is loaded? It displays a default alert dialogue when a web page loads completely with images and text content. The DOMContentLoaded event happens on the document object. Where does this (supposedly) Gibson quote come from? If the name doesn't identify an existing context, a new context is created and given the specified name. How to clear form after submit in Javascript without using reset? For the window object, the load event is fired when the whole webpage (HTML) has loaded fully, including all dependent resources, including JavaScript files, CSS files, and images. Specifies the height of the content area, including scrollbars. in the event of another call of this function. Why are trials on "Law & Order" in the New York Supreme Court? In this window, click "HTML Application for TypeScript" under Visual C#. how to write onload function in angular 4? How can I get new selection in "select" in Angular 2? an image has been loaded: Using the onload event to deal with cookies: Get certifiedby completinga course today! If no parameter type is defined, TypeScript will default to using any, unless additional type information is available as shown in the Default Parameters and Type Alias sections . Let's learn about how to write types that describe functions. How do I align things in the following tabular environment? For example, if I want to have a pop-up, should I write (directly inside the